http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5201049-A

Outgoing Links

Predicate Object
assignee http://rdf.ncbi.nlm.nih.gov/pubchem/patentassignee/MD5_e757fd4fedc4fe825bb81b1b466a0947
classificationCPCAdditional http://rdf.ncbi.nlm.nih.gov/pubchem/patentcpc/G06F2209-5011
http://rdf.ncbi.nlm.nih.gov/pubchem/patentcpc/G06F2209-5018
classificationCPCInventive http://rdf.ncbi.nlm.nih.gov/pubchem/patentcpc/G06F9-5033
http://rdf.ncbi.nlm.nih.gov/pubchem/patentcpc/G06F9-505
classificationIPCInventive http://rdf.ncbi.nlm.nih.gov/pubchem/patentipc/G06F9-50
http://rdf.ncbi.nlm.nih.gov/pubchem/patentipc/G06F9-48
filingDate 1991-09-20-04:00^^<http://www.w3.org/2001/XMLSchema#date>
grantDate 1993-04-06-04:00^^<http://www.w3.org/2001/XMLSchema#date>
inventor http://rdf.ncbi.nlm.nih.gov/pubchem/patentinventor/MD5_921ad40e2593a3679f71551e541d97d4
publicationDate 1993-04-06-04:00^^<http://www.w3.org/2001/XMLSchema#date>
publicationNumber US-5201049-A
titleOfInvention System for executing applications program concurrently/serially on different virtual machines
abstract A method to preserve system resources during the execution of distributed application programs in an SNA type data processing network that supports program to program communication between an Intelligent Work Station (IWS) and a host processor in accordance with SNA Logical Unit 6.2 protocols when a Virtual Machine Pool Manager exists at the host processor and functions to, n (1) create a pool of virtual machines at the host processor that are brought to a run ready state prior to any program to program communication, n (2) dynamically assign an idle run ready virtual machine to process each request from the IWS involving one application program so that sequential requests from the one program are assigned to different ones of the idle virtual machines and run concurrently, and n (3) provide a Pool Manager Data Structure for use by the Pool Manager during the step of dynamically assigning the idle run ready virtual machines in the pool. The Operating System for the IWS attaches a process identifier (PRID) and a thread identifier (THRID) to predefined segments of the resident application program that include LU 6.2 type conversation requests. The ID are transmitted to the host at the time a request is transmitted to permit the Virtual Machine Pool Manager to decide, based on the transmitted ID and previously received IDs whether to assign the request to an active or idle virtual machine in the pool. If the ID is the same as a segment being run on an active machine, the request are assigned to the same machine. If the transmitted (THRID) is different, the request is assigned to an idle machine in the pool. Therefore, predefined segments can be executed concurrently on different assigned virtual machines at the host only when the application program segments have been assigned different THRIDS by the terminal operating system.
isCitedBy http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9209983-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6138174-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2003177176-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8762993-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2006174223-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6922774-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6163797-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8090797-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6934325-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2009106780-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5355488-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6880002-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9202237-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6728746-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7296267-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8331391-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7257815-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-10042657-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2009055234-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8161475-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2008263639-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2003065676-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9104514-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7934090-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7093258-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7574496-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9667604-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8306040-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8078728-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2007083655-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8230419-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2005147120-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2002158908-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7769004-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-10264058-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2006069662-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2014109088-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8326943-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2009238181-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2001023426-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8954048-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2005108407-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5519833-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9600316-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2006041761-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2010281181-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9853948-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9853917-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2007028237-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/WO-2012030653-A3
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/EP-2425334-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7287186-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8194674-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6256637-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2004019890-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6681238-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7257584-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6704764-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2010281102-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2012180039-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5421014-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8352964-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2007147368-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6546431-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6567837-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6957427-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2006294401-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8732308-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8171483-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9967200-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8068503-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2007083610-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7643484-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9391964-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/CN-103080920-B
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5692193-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2007245348-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/CN-103080920-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5898855-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2004148602-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6009266-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5649131-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2004010788-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5946463-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-8472928-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2009132401-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5257376-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2011173618-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5867725-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2009138295-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9021494-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7996834-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-7428754-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-2008082977-A1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9509638-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-5848231-A
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6990666-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-6182106-B1
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9009721-B2
http://rdf.ncbi.nlm.nih.gov/pubchem/patent/US-9009720-B2
priorityDate 1988-09-29-04:00^^<http://www.w3.org/2001/XMLSchema#date>
type http://data.epo.org/linked-data/def/patent/Publication

Incoming Links

Predicate Subject
isDiscussedBy http://rdf.ncbi.nlm.nih.gov/pubchem/compound/CID128061
http://rdf.ncbi.nlm.nih.gov/pubchem/substance/SID419562910

Total number of triples: 118.